Buckthorn removal services focus on identifying and eliminating invasive buckthorn plants from residential properties. These services typically involve carefully cutting back or uprooting the plants to prevent them from spreading further. In some cases, contractors may also treat the remaining roots with herbicides to ensure the plants do not regrow. The goal is to restore the health of the landscape by removing these unwanted plants that can quickly take over and disrupt native plant growth.

This service helps address a variety of problems caused by buckthorn. The invasive nature of buckthorn can lead to reduced biodiversity by crowding out native trees and shrubs. It can also create dense thickets that are difficult to navigate or enjoy, and in some cases, it may damage existing trees by competing for resources. The overview below groups typical Buckthorn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bozeman, MT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Jobs - Many local contractors handle small-scale buckthorn removal projects for between $250 and $600. These typically involve removing a few shrubs or a small patch on residential properties in Bozeman and nearby areas. Most rout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and accessibility.

Medium-Sized Projects - For larger areas or more extensive infestations, costs generally range from $600 to $1,500. These projects often involve clearing multiple patches or moderate land areas and are common for property owners seeking comprehensive removal services.

Large or Complex Jobs - Larger, more complex projects such as invasive species removal on extensive land parcels can reach $1,500 to $3,000 or more. These jobs may include site preparation or multiple visits, with fewer projects falling into this higher tier.

Full Land Clearing or Restoration - Complete land clearing or restoration involving extensive buckthorn removal and site rehab can cost $3,000 to $5,000+ in the Bozeman area. Such projects are less frequent and often involve significant planning and effort by local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why should I consider professional buckthorn removal services? Professional services can effectively and safely remove buckthorn, helping to prevent its spread and reduce the risk of it overtaking native plants in the area.

What methods do local contractors typically use to remove buckthorn? Contractors often use a combination of mechanical removal, such as cutting and digging, and may recommend follow-up treatments to ensure the invasive plant does not regrow.

How can I identify buckthorn on my property? Buckthorn typically has dark, multiple stems, oval-shaped leaves, and produces small black berries. Consulting with local service providers can help confirm identification.

Is it necessary to remove all buckthorn plants, including small seedlings? Yes, removing all buckthorn, including seedlings, is important to prevent re-establishment and future spread of this invasive species.

How do local contractors ensure the removal process is effective? They assess the extent of infestation, use appropriate removal techniques, and may recommend follow-up treatments to manage regrowth and ensure thorough removal.
